You have seen him on television, heard his speeches on the internet, visited his historic rallies and 'followed' him on social media. Now, Prime Minister Narendra Modi wants to interact with you through the radio!
From Kashmir to Kanyakumari, from Maharashtra to Manipur the PM would interact with the people of India.
The PM wants you to outline the nature and structure of the radio address. He wants to know the following aspects of the address from you:
Frequency of the address
(How often should the address be- monthly, once in two months, once in three months? Should the days be decided- for example 2nd and 4th Sundays of the month at a fixed time 11AM)
Nature of the address and topics
(What ground should it cover- should it be a general address to the nation or should it cover specific topics such as good governance, women empowerment, self-sufficiency in defence)
Structure of the address
(What format should it follow)
Name of the address
(Suggest a title for the series of addresses. The name must be creative and capture the true essence behind such a programme)

So, share your views and become a part of yet another landmark idea that celebrates India and India’s unity.
